javascript 数组slice和splice
2024-10-16 08:56:59
var a = [1,4,2,5,6,9,10];
console.log(a.slice(3)); //[5,6,9,10]
console.log(a.slice(-3)); //[6,9,10]
console.log(a.slice(2,4)); //[2,5]
console.log(a.splice(4)); //[6,9,10]
console.log(a); //[1,4,2,5]
//splice()方法是在数组中插入或删除元素的通用方法
//区别于slice的地方是:splice会改变原数组
var b = [1,4,2,5,6,9,10];
console.log(b.splice(-3)); //[6,9,10]
console.log(b); //[1,4,2,5]
console.log(b.splice()) //[]
console.log(b.splice(1,1,[1,2],4)); // [4]
console.log(b); //[1,[1,2],4,2,5]
最新文章
- 如何用java写出无副作用的代码
- VC++ 最小化到托盘、恢复
- JS组件系列——封装自己的JS组件
- hdu 1715 大菲波数 高精度和运算,水
- DNA Pairing
- OracleINSERT提示IGNORE_ROW_ON_DUPKEY_INDEX
- Delphi MDI程序 父窗体如何调用当前活动子窗体的函数/过程
- ios 数字禁止变成电话号码
- Java中关于String的split(String regex, int limit) 方法
- javax inect
- DesignPatternPrinciple(设计模式原则)二
- Netty实现高性能IOT服务器(Groza)之精尽代码篇中
- 简单又实用的分享!SharePoint母版页引用(实战)
- 【English】十、";谓语的地方";看到有两个动词:I go say hello.、非谓语形式
- 活代码LINQ——06
- 移动端Web开发,ios下 input为圆角
- Android开源系列:仿网易Tab分类排序控件实现
- 大杂烩 -- Java内存布局【图】以及java各种存储区【详解】
- 机器学习入门-文本特征-使用LDA主题模型构造标签 1.LatentDirichletAllocation(LDA用于构建主题模型) 2.LDA.components(输出各个词向量的权重值)
- MVC应用程序显示Flash(swf)视频